NEWS IN ADVERTISEMENTS.
Bon© and Shaw advertise on the front page six new properties for sale or exchange.
Barley’s on Saturday give special discount of 3/- in the pound off all *hats, caps, collars, shirts, ties etc. They are agents for Petone all-wool suits £4 10/-.
Large entries of poultry, pigs, dairy stock and farm requisites and produce will be sold by T. Cunningham and Co. at their market sale to-morrow, also a very nice ironframed piano will be sold to highest bidder.
To-morrow at 11 a.m. sharp, .Messrs J. S. Sharp and Co. will offer a nice line of P.B. I.R. diiu’.s and drakes, also an extra clwice line of Rhode Island pullets. At 11.30 sharp a good line of corrugated iron will be sold to the highest bidder, also on account of client leaving Hastings a quantity of household furniture, which will be sold without reserve.
Messrs Gill Bros.’ entries for their weekly market sale to-morrow ar© of a very attractive nature. Poultry include & nice lino of White Leghorn pullets laying, also table birds, cockerel 4 ’, etc Pigs are exceptionally good, including weaners, porkers, slips, and stores also a Tain, sow due end of month Dairy stock will lie sold with a guarantee.
